Output 31a4adf8ce242575ba833324aeb63c8fe19112813526a4e5a494c75755ff9b15:0

value
44043607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 938cfeaf3f7201aa78f5273999d33fd95edb031c OP_EQUAL
address
MMMLU89LkEqTZn5AWGv8gwn1yRQkpsU2Kh
transaction
31a4adf8ce242575ba833324aeb63c8fe19112813526a4e5a494c75755ff9b15
spent
true